Length of the WEP key. The key length values used by the SNMP do not include the initialization vector in the length. On the web UI, longer key length values may be shown which include the 24-bit initialization vector. For example, a key length of 40 bits (not including initialization vector) is equivalent to a key length of 64 bits (with initialization vector).
